What are sinuses? Sinuses are air-filled spaces in the skull which is lines by membranes. These membranes will produce a thin secretion to trap dirt particles and keep the nasal passages moist. Introduction Allergic rhinitis is an overreaction of the immune system(body defense system that often helps in protecting your body from non infectious inhaled particles) to the allergen. Introduction A feeling of burning or squeezing pain while swallowing. This sensation may be felt high in the neck or lower down, behind the breastbone (sternum). Introduction Foreign body is often accidentally inserted, swallowed or aspirated/inhaled and is not common in adult. Foreign body can accidentally inhaled/aspirated and stuck in the airways and lung. Introduction What is vocal cord? Is the structure in the larynx that will close and vibrate during vocalisation/phonation (produce voice/swallowing) and open during breathing. Introduction Sleep apnea is a condition that occurs when a person regularly stop breathing during sleep.Each episodes of stop breathing may take 10 seconds or longer.
